Payroll employment, earnings and hours, August 2017
Average weekly earnings of non-farm payroll employees were $975 in August, up 0.9% from the previous month. Compared with August 2016, earnings increased 1.7%.
From arrest to conviction: Court outcomes of police-reported sexual assaults in Canada, 2009 to 2014
In Canada, sexual assault is one of the most underreported crimes to police, and of those incidents which are reported, a low number make their way through the criminal justice system.
Railway carloadings, August 2017
The volume of rail freight carried in Canada totalled 30.8 million tonnes in August, up 3.2% from the same month last year.
Construction Union Wage Rate Index, September 2017
The Construction Union Wage Rate Index (including supplements) for Canada remained unchanged in September compared with the previous month. The composite index increased 1.0% in the 12 months to September.
Dairy statistics, August 2017
The volume of yogurt produced in August was 33 561 tonnes, up 2.4% from August 2016. Production of cottage cheese increased 10.3% from the same month a year earlier to 1 915 tonnes in August 2017, while cheddar cheese production increased 9.2% over the same period to 13 921 tonnes.
